Experience
Since May 2019, Norman Bedtke has been working at Fraunhofer IMW in Leipzig as a research fellow in the Crowd Innovation Unit (from January 1, 2025, part of Fraunhofer ISI). Prior to that, he studied economics at the Friedrich Schiller University in Jena with a focus on innovation economics, graduating in 2009 with a degree in economics. In his subsequent work as a researcher at the Helmholtz Centre for Environmental Research in Leipzig, he focused on social scientific water research. In his doctoral thesis, he analyzed the transformation of network-connected infrastructure systems using the example of German water management from an institutional economic perspective.
